It took us almost exactly a week from the time the appraisal came back at our purchase price to get through underwriting. I got my clear to close today. We were scheduled for 2/23 but I'm trying to move it up to 2/20.
I had three total conditions I had to clear during underwriting.
Verification of Employment
Letter of explanation for property my father owned and sold last year (we are Sr./Jr.)
Explanation of large deposits because my paycheck was paper instead of direct deposit last month because of changing payroll processors.
That was it. Everything else was smooth sailing.

The lender is still going to do a soft pull the day before closing. That's when I have to have the letter from Capital One. When they do the soft pull thats when that new inquiry will show up.
Make sure your taxes are complete and you owe nothing. And make sureyour credit profile has no surprises in it. Do not apply for any credit and do not allow anything to pull your credit. Do not use your credit cards. And do not make any changes of employment or banking. Have all of your documents readyand when they ask for something get it to them. do not delay in any way.

It's not so much don't use your cards as it is don't go out and buy $1000 worth of furniture because you're approved. Making your normal purchases is probably okay. Just don't spend too much to change your DTI

You don't want to go out and put all your new furniture deposits on there, or live off of them because you can't touch yourbank accounts of something. You want to make sure the financialpicture you gave them in the start is the same at the end.
